To get the full Darkest Dungeon experience, the DLC packs are non-negotiable. Each adds significant depth, new mechanics, and even more ways for your heroes to lose their minds. 1. The Crimson Court
This is the most substantial expansion. It introduces a new dungeon region (The Courtyard), a new hero class (The Flagellant), and a persistent "Crimson Curse" mechanic. It’s designed for veterans, as the blood-sucking vampires add a layer of resource management that can be overwhelming for beginners. 2. The Color of Madness
Inspired by Lovecraft’s "The Colour Out of Space," this DLC introduces an endless wave-based survival mode at the Farmstead. It’s perfect for testing high-level team compositions and earning "Comets" to buy powerful Trinkets. 3. The Shieldbreaker
A smaller but impactful DLC that adds the Shieldbreaker hero. She is a tactical powerhouse, capable of piercing armor and breaking enemy guards, though her "nightmares" add a unique challenge during camping. 4. The Butcher's Circus
The latest major "new" addition to the Darkest Dungeon universe on Switch is the Butcher's Circus. This update brought PvP (Player vs. Player) combat to the Hamlet. You can now take your best builds online to fight other players in a no-stakes arena, earning cosmetic rewards and prestige. New Content and the Future of the Franchise

Manage Stress Early: Don’t wait for a hero to hit 100 Stress. Use the Abbey or Tavern in the Hamlet frequently.
Upgrade the Stagecoach: Your first priority should be increasing the number of heroes that arrive each week.
Learn to Retreat: There is no shame in abandoning a quest. Losing a party of level 5 heroes is far more expensive than failing a mission.
